The North Carolina Department of Public Instruction (NCDPI) is charged with implementing the state's public school laws for pre-kindergarten through 12th grade public schools at the direction of the State Superintendent of Public Instruction and State Board of Education.

Office of Early Learning (OEL):

The purpose of the Office of Early Learning (OEL) is to provide leadership, technical assistance, professional development, and other support to local education agencies for the implementation of evidence-informed practices in Preschool – Grade 3 programs, including the NC Early Learning Inventory. The OEL promotes the alignment of Preschool – Grade 3 program components to address the unique needs of young children and their families, with an emphasis on standards, curricula, assessment, and evidence-informed instructional practices. In addition, the OEL provides oversight for federally funded preschool programs, including Preschool Exceptional Children, Title I Preschool, and the Head Start State Collaboration Office.
